Volkswagen Taigun

Volkswagen is presented at the Auto Show in San Paulo, a new compact crossover concept called Taigun. The car, based on the compact Up!, reaches 3859 mm long, 1724 mm wide and 1559 mm high with a wheelbase of 2470 mm. Outwardly the car is executed in the general corporate Volkswagen style and reminds larger Touareg and Tiguan. By the way, the name of a new concept is an anagram of a name of the last and is urged to emphasize unambiguously the general style and target audience of a novelty — inhabitants of big cities. It is necessary to note also wide wheel arches, an angular form of forward headlights and back lamps, and also two exhaust pipes and the railing on a roof. Founders chose as firm color of a concept shade dark blue under the name Seaside Blue.

 

Saloon Volkswagen Taigun nominally designed for five passengers, although, as in the case of the Up!, can comfortably get a maximum of four. Interior design concept is also similar to a compact, the underlying, a modest, but tasteful. But the car boasts a decent amount of luggage - 280 liters. With the rear seats folded, it increases to 987 liters, which is pretty good for a car of this size.


Under the hood of Volkswagen Taigun housed more powerful version of one-liter three-cylinder engine, mounted on the Up!. Turbocharged engine with direct injection system is able to deliver 110 h.p and 175  Nm peak torque. The motor is paired with a 6-step mechanics. Acceleration to 100 km/h - 9.2 seconds, fuel consumption per 100 km - 4.7 liters. In this case, the car makers emphasize that the drive only the front, because the model is specifically designed for city driving.

 

The company made ​​a big bet on this model and expect to sell it since 2015 on global markets.
